A liter, or litre, is a unit of volume in the metric system. A liter is defined as the volume of a cube that is 10 centimeters on a side. There are about 3.785 liters in a U.S. gallon.

Convert Liters to Gallons (L → gal) To convert liters to gallons, multiply the number of liters by 0.264172. For example, to convert 5 liters to gallons: 5 × 0.264172 ≈ 1.32086 gallons. For quick estimations, you can use the approximation that 1 liter is about 1/4 of a gallon.

Liter (L): The standard metric unit for volume, originally defined as the volume occupied by 1 kilogram of pure water at 4°C. Equal to 1,000 cubic centimeters.
